Any chance to get a fecal done? Since the eyelid is pink, I'd want to know exactly what needs treating. I believe lice or mites can also make them anemic. Have you taken temp? Ivermectin (shot) would take care of most worms and lice/mites. If it's cocci the treatment would differ, corrid 5 days, thiamin shot days 1,3,5.
